Is A Higher Abbe Value Better?

Abbe value describes how much a lens material disperses light into colors. Higher numbers indicate lower chromatic dispersion and generally less color fringing. Perceived benefit depends on prescription strength, frame size, and viewing habits. Many users do well across materials when lenses are centered and coated properly.

Why Abbe Value Matters In Everyday Vision

In strong prescriptions, peripheral viewing shows differences more clearly. Higher Abbe materials can feel more comfortable for prolonged reading or screen work. Design features like asphericity also affect edge perception. Balance material choice with frame and prescription needs.

Does A Higher Abbe Value Always Win

Not always, because weight, thickness, and safety also matter. High Abbe glass is optically strong but heavy and less impact resistant. Modern plastics with coatings offer a practical compromise. Personal tolerance for fringing varies among users.

Where Do Abbe Values Typically Fall

CR-39 is around the upper 50s, many high-index plastics range from the low 30s to 40s. Polycarbonate is typically around the low 30s. Glass can be near the high 50s but is heavier. Ranges vary by manufacturer and formulation.

How Can Design Reduce Fringing

Aspheric and atoric designs control off-axis aberrations. Smaller eye sizes keep viewing closer to the optical center. Precise measurements limit unwanted effects. Coatings enhance contrast for more comfortable vision.

FAQs About Abbe Value Benefits

When Might Abbe Be Less Important

Mild prescriptions and small frames minimize peripheral viewing issues. Users may notice little difference across materials in everyday tasks. Other priorities like weight and durability can take precedence. Comfort testing with a professional helps guide choice.

What does the Abbe value measure?

The Abbe value measures how much light dispersion occurs within a lens material. A higher Abbe value indicates less chromatic aberration and greater clarity, while a lower value may cause color fringing.

How does Abbe value affect lens performance?

Lenses with higher Abbe values provide sharper vision and better color fidelity, whereas low Abbe values can result in slight blurring or color distortions, particularly in higher prescription strengths.

What is an ideal Abbe value for everyday wear?

Materials with an Abbe value above 40 are generally considered good for everyday lenses. However, the choice of lens material also depends on factors like prescription strength, thickness and budget.
